Numbers Carried
Company Number Date From
London, Midland & Scottish Railway 6103 on 11/09/1927
British Railways 46103 m/e 10/1948

Names Carried
Date From Name
11/09/1927 ROYAL SCOTS FUSILIER

Locomotive Specifics
Class 7P
Company History LMS
Rebuild History
ClassFrom
Royal Scot (Scot)11/09/1927
Wheels 4-6-0
Builder North British Locomotive Company, Glasgow
To Service Wed 11/09/1927
Withdrawal Wed 19/12/1962
Service Life 35 yrs, 3 mths , 8 dys

Disposal
Scrapping During 09/1963

03/06/1961 Leeds-Birmingham-Bristol line With the advent of the Summer t.t. several steam workings have gone over to Type 4 Sulzers; whilst only 3 A3 Pacifics are left at Holbeck, Saltley has gained 3 class 6P and 11 Class 7P 4-6-0s viz., 45579, 45648/9, 45532/40, 46100/3/12/8/22/41/57/60/2. It is presumed that these latter will be utilised on Saturdays for the many extra trains which are run (and upon which 2-10-0s were utilised last year). SLS/196107
05/05/1962 Saltley MPD 46106 Gordon Highlander lost its nameplates on 5th May and together with 46103 went on loan to Leicester Midland whilst 46118 went on loan to Leicester G.C.; 92167 (fitted mechanical stoker) is transferred to Tyne Dock whilst 92165/6 are expected to follow. They did in fact commence the journey on 22nd May but only got as far as Canklow where they were sent back to Saltley. SLS/196206
03/06/1962 Saltley MPD The following Royal Scots have been placed in store-46103/22/32/60 all ex Works; 46157/62; 46123 was under repair on 3rd June but was also scheduled for storage. SLS/196207
